抽奖活动跨天重置

This commit is contained in:
sk 2024-10-25 10:35:53 +08:00
parent 9cc386b25f
commit 3bfd8f30df
1 changed files with 4 additions and 2 deletions

View File

@ -438,13 +438,15 @@ func (l *LotteryMgr) Init() {
ld := l.GetData(v.IdStr, d.CId)
ld.LotteryData = d
ld.Platform = v.IdStr
if !common.TsInSameDay(ld.StartTs, time.Now().Unix()) {
if l.PlatformConfig[v.IdStr] != nil {
if !common.TsInSameDay(ld.StartTs, time.Now().Unix()) && l.PlatformConfig[v.IdStr].IsCycle {
ld.Reset()
}
}
}
}
}
}
func (l *LotteryMgr) Update() {
for _, v := range l.Data {